Carrot muffins
  • Difficulty: Easy
  • Cost: Cheap
  • Preparation time: 15 Minutes
  • Portions: 12
  • Cooking methods: Oven
  • Cuisine: Italian
  • Seasonality: All seasons

Ingredients to prepare Carrot Muffins

  • 1 cup cups Carrots
  • 1/2 cup cups Sugar
  • 1.75 oz oz Peeled almonds
  • 1 cup cups Flour
  • 2 Eggs
  • 1/4 cup cups Sunflower oil
  • 1 packet Cream of tartar (or baking powder)
  • Lemons

How to make Carrot Muffins

  • Let’s start preparing the Carrot and Almond Muffins by cleaning the carrots, removing the ends, and peeling the outer part of the carrots before grating them. Blend the carrots with the almonds and sugar slightly.

  • Pour the sifted flour and cream of tartar into a bowl, add oil, eggs, and grated lemon peel, mix everything, and then add the almonds with sugar and carrots. Preheat the oven to 350°F.

  • Fill the muffin liners placed in the muffin tray with the batter up to 3/4 full. If you don’t have a muffin tray, place the liners directly on the oven tray, or if you don’t have liners, pour the batter onto a slightly greased and floured muffin tray.

  • When the oven is hot and has reached the right temperature, bake the carrot and almond muffins and let them bake for 30 minutes. Use the toothpick test to check if they are done; if the toothpick is still wet, continue baking for a few more minutes. Once cooked, remove the Carrot and Almond Muffins and let them cool.

How to store Carrot Muffins

Carrot Muffins can be stored in a cake container with a lid or inside a bag.
